Tesla Motors Finally Announces Production Schedule

After a long struggle to get their zero-emissions Electric Vehicle Roadster to market, Tesla Motors has finally announced that it will start pumping out 100 Roadsters per month starting early next year. While the first 900 units have been spoken for, Tesla is opening two California dealerships (Los Angeles and Menlo Park) to sell its future inventory.

Developed with help from Lotus Cars, the Tesla Roadster packs impressive performance stats given its green pedigree and semi-affordable $89,000 price tag. Off the line, the Roadster sprints from 0-60 mph in 3.9 seconds, beating out most standard Ferraris.

The downside? After seeing the Tesla Roadster in person several times, we’d have to say that the design is mediocre at best, in part because of the car’s extremely small size. But hey, at $89k, you can’t ask for everything.
